研究概览

简要总结

This study evaluates the efficacy of the HIFU for the treatment of benign thyroid nodules with the FastScan version using assessment of patient experience and adverse event reporting.

详细描述

Echopulse is specially designed, manufactured and CE marked for treating benign thyroid nodules. HIFU is a completely alternative to surgery which utilizes high-energy ultrasound to deliver a large amount of sound energy to a focal point to rapidly induce tissue heating to 85-90°C.This initiates tissue coagulation followed by tissue necrosis ablating the targeted area.

In a previous european feasibility study performed at 1 site (Bulgaria), 20 benign thyroid nodules were treated. The HIFU treatment was well tolerated and showed efficacy.

入选标准

  • Male or female patient 18 years or older.
  • Patient presenting with at least one thyroid nodule with no signs of malignancy:
  • Non suspect clinically and at ultrasonography imaging
  • Benign cytological diagnosis at FNAB (fine-needle aspiration biopsy) from the last 6 months
  • Normal serum calcitonin
  • No history of neck irradiation
  • Normal TSH (thyroid-stimulating hormone)
  • Targeted nodule accessible and eligible to HIFU
  • Absence of abnormal vocal cord mobility at laryngoscopy
  • Nodule diameter ≥ 10mm measured by ultrasound
  • Composition of the targeted nodule(s) : predominantly solid
  • Patient has signed a written informed consent.

排除标准

  • Head and/or neck disease that prevents hyperextension of neck
  • Known history of thyroid cancer or other neoplasias in the neck region
  • History of neck irradiation
  • Macrocalcification inducing a shadow in the thyroid significant enough to preclude the HIFU treatment
  • Posterior position of the nodule if the thickness of the nodule is <15mm
  • Pregnant or lactating woman
  • Any contraindication to the assigned analgesia/anaesthesia.
